The Chapel of the Holy Cross is a scenic Catholic chapel built into the mesas of Sedona, Arizona, designed by architect Marguerite Brunswig Staude and completed in 1957.
It is one of the main tourist attractions in the area and is also the site of one of the so-called Sedona vortices.
